RLException: [rs_camera.launch] is neither a launch file in package [realsense2_camera] nor is [realsense2_camera] a launch file name The traceback for the exception was written to the log file
时间: 2023-06-13 14:05:16 浏览: 485
rs_imu_stereo.launch
这个错误提示是说在 `realsense2_camera` 包中没有名为 `rs_camera.launch` 的 launch 文件,或者 `realsense2_camera` 不是一个有效的 launch 文件名。
可能的原因和解决方案:
1. 检查是否正确安装了 `realsense2_camera` 包。可以通过在终端中使用 `rospack find realsense2_camera` 命令来检查该包是否存在。
2. 检查 launch 文件名是否正确。确保你的 launch 文件名是 `rs_camera.launch`,而不是其他名称。
3. 检查 launch 文件是否位于正确的路径中。在终端中使用 `roscd realsense2_camera` 命令进入 `realsense2_camera` 包的目录,然后进入 `launch` 文件夹,检查是否存在 `rs_camera.launch` 文件。
4. 如果以上方法都没有解决问题,可以尝试重新编译 `realsense2_camera` 包并重新启动 ROS。可能出现这种情况的原因是包中某些文件被更改但没有重新编译。
阅读全文